Crucial Safety Measures for Coastal Tide Pooling
Before setting foot on the rocky shore, the most important step is consulting a local tide table. The ideal window for tide pooling starts one hour before the lowest low tide, giving you ample time to explore before the water begins to rise again. Never turn your back on the ocean, as unexpected sneaker waves can sweep over exposed shelves, and always keep a close eye on incoming water levels to avoid getting trapped on a disappearing ledge.
Rocky intertidal zones are notoriously hazardous, covered in slick algae, sharp barnacles, and unstable kelp beds. Moving slowly, keeping your center of gravity low, and avoiding stepping on wet, dark green algae will prevent nasty slips and falls. For families exploring with dogs, keeping pets on a short, sturdy leash is essential to prevent them from leaping into deep pools, disturbing wildlife, or slipping down steep crevices.

How to Protect Fragile Marine Life and Pet Paws
Tide pools are highly concentrated, fragile ecosystems where resident organisms endure extreme conditions to survive. Every step you take can crush delicate barnacles, mussels, and anemones, so always stick to bare rock surfaces or designated paths whenever possible. Teach children to look with their eyes or use an underwater viewer rather than poking, prying, or removing creatures from their watery homes.
Keeping your dog under control is equally vital for both the marine life and your pet’s safety. Curious dogs may try to sniff or bite sea anemones, crabs, or jellyfish washed up on the shore, which can result in painful stings or pinches to their sensitive noses. Keep your pet on a short leash, prevent them from drinking salty pool water—which causes rapid dehydration and stomach upset—and steer them clear of decomposing kelp piles that often harbor hidden glass or sharp hooks.
Cleaning and Rinsing Your Gear After the Saltwater
Saltwater is incredibly destructive, accelerating rust on metal hardware, degrading technical fabrics, and breaking down rubber soles over time. Once you return home from a tide pooling adventure, dedicating time to a thorough freshwater rinse is the single best way to extend the lifespan of your gear. Hose down water shoes, dog booties, life jackets, and leashes with clean tap water, paying close attention to zippers, buckles, and metal clips where salt crystals like to accumulate.
After rinsing, hang all gear in a well-ventilated, shaded area out of direct sunlight to dry completely before storing. Storing damp gear in enclosed spaces or car trunks will quickly lead to mold, mildew, and foul odors that are nearly impossible to eliminate. For items like the portable rinse shower and dry bags, leave them open to air dry completely inside to prevent internal mildew growth before packing them away for the season.
